To remove the alternator from a 1994 Buick Roadmaster, first disconnect the negative battery cable to ensure safety. Then, remove the serpentine belt by loosening the tensioner and sliding the belt off the alternator pulley. Next, disconnect the electrical connectors from the alternator and remove the mounting bolts. Finally, lift the alternator out of the engine bay.

It can be helpful to know the firing order of a cars engine. For a 1994 Buick Roadmaster the engine firing order is 1-8-4-3-6-5-7-2.
